- 5.0 (1)·Hard·33.7 mi·Est. 13–14.5 hrStage 14 of the Mittelland Route. The penultimate day tour of the Mittelland route follows the Elbe from the “German Florence” to Heidenau. It continues to Stolpen, where you should pay a visit to the historic castle, to the stage destination Neustadt in Saxony. Highlights: - Dresden, city of culture - Stolpen Castle
- Hard·21.3 mi·Est. 9–10 hrThe route leads through forest and farm roads. The asphalt content is rather low. There are 3 smaller single trails along the Wesenitz. "Brave" can try it with the touring bike, but should then be prepared for pushing passages. In terms of landscape, it goes through the forest area of the Massenei, along the Wesenitz and through the Karswald. Stolpen Castle can be seen near Rennersdorf. The highest points are the Großer Stern and the Tanneberg at 301 m.
